1. Importance of Plain-Language Summaries in Clinical Trials
Plain-language summaries (PLS) are simplified versions of clinical trial results intended to make research findings accessible to a wider audience, including patients, caregivers, and the general public. Given the complexities often associated with clinical trial data, employing clear and straightforward language can facilitate better understanding and informed decision-making. Regulatory bodies such as EMA and FDA have increasingly advocated for the adoption of PLS as part of their commitment to transparency in clinical research.
Creating effective plain-language summaries involves several key steps:
- Identify Key Findings: Focus on the outcomes that matter most to the target audience, including efficacy, safety, and overall implications of the research.
- Simplify Technical Language: Translate scientific terminology and jargon into lay language, ensuring clarity without compromising the integrity of the data.
- Engage Stakeholders: Include feedback from representatives of varied target audiences to ensure that the summary resonates and is comprehensible.
- Visual Aids: Incorporate graphs, charts, or infographics that can convey complex information succinctly and effectively.

2. Lay Results: Translating Clinical Data into Understandable Findings
Lay results complement plain-language summaries by providing concise interpretations of complex data outputs from clinical trials. While PLS focuses on the broader context and implications of findings, lay results zero in on the specific data, such as numerical outcomes of treatment effects and side effects.
The following measures are essential when crafting lay results:
- Summarize Statistical Outcomes: Translate p-values, confidence intervals, and other statistical findings into understandable effects (e.g., “X out of 100 patients experienced a side effect”).
- Detail Clinical Significance: Beyond statistical significance, explain the clinical relevance of results, assisting stakeholders in understanding what findings mean for patient care.
- Avoid Over-interpretation: Present findings accurately without exaggeration, ensuring that no misleading conclusions are drawn from the data.

3. Regulatory Requirements for Public Disclosure of Clinical Trial Outputs
Regulatory agencies across different jurisdictions mandate the public disclosure of clinical trial results. The obligation to share results not only reinforces a commitment to transparency but also serves to avoid redundancy in research efforts.
In the US, the FDA requires that all clinical trials registered on ClinicalTrials.gov disclose results within a specified timeframe, thus establishing a model for data sharing.[1] In the EU, the EMA has instituted a policy that obliges developers to submit trial results, irrespective of their outcome, ensuring an unbiased dissemination of information.
The steps necessary for compliance with these regulatory requirements include:
- Register the Study: Before commencement, ensure that the study is registered in a publicly accessible database like ClinicalTrials.gov.
- Document Quality Control Measures: While compiling results, maintain rigorous quality control procedures to guarantee accuracy and reliability.
- Timely Reporting: Ensure results are reported within regulatory deadlines to avoid penalties or issues with regulatory compliance.

5. Challenges and Solutions in Clinical Trial Transparency
As clinical operations professionals strive to enhance transparency around clinical trial outputs, various challenges can arise. From obtaining informed consent for data sharing to aligning different regulatory standards, organizations must be vigilant and proactive.
Some common challenges include:
- Data Privacy Concerns: Maintaining patient confidentiality while sharing results remains a critical hurdle. Utilizing anonymization techniques can help address these concerns.
- Varying International Standards: Navigating through disparate requirements for data reporting across regions may lead to compliance complexities. Developing a robust understanding of regional regulations can mitigate these issues.
- Stakeholder Engagement: Engaging diverse stakeholders can be difficult, especially when trying to align their expectations regarding what constitutes valuable information.
Solutions to these challenges involve:
- Clear Communication Policies: Define clear communication policies that outline how data will be shared while ensuring regulatory compliance.
- Regular Training Updates: Ensure team members receive regular training related to current regulations and best practices in data sharing and transparency.
- Establishing Clear Timelines: Develop a timeline for data sharing that includes stages for dissemination of results to internal and external stakeholders.
By navigating these challenges, clinical research organizations can foster a culture of transparency that not only complies with regulations but also enhances public trust.
